Transaction 80c3614a139bfbc9ca9f90c2dea9b352f65c73f3d7a3effc4c4f6feaccbfe9bc

1 Input
2 Outputs
  • 80c3614a139bfbc9ca9f90c2dea9b352f65c73f3d7a3effc4c4f6feaccbfe9bc:0
  • value  21934836
    address  3D2HsWA4dZ4LXH1doE4CqtSgFzG34GJSNX
  • 80c3614a139bfbc9ca9f90c2dea9b352f65c73f3d7a3effc4c4f6feaccbfe9bc:1
  • value  1148000
    address  192pak7SMpA3PteahtoKjgHw6zW7HD1Cuq